Add 56/21 and 28/20

1st number: 2 14/21, 2nd number: 1 8/20

56/21 + 28/20 is 61/15.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 21 and 20 is 420

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 420
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 21 × 20 = 420,
    56/21 = 56 × 20/21 × 20 = 1120/420
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 20 × 21 = 420,
    28/20 = 28 × 21/20 × 21 = 588/420
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    1120/420 + 588/420 = 1120 + 588/420 = 1708/420
  5. 1708/420 simplified gives 61/15
  6. So, 56/21 + 28/20 = 61/15
